The brothers Chris and Laine Sheridan joined forces with longtime friend Joey C. Jones and drummer Randy St. John to create the biggest and baddest greatest rock band ever – SWEET SAVAGE.

Over the next five they traveled to the United States, causing more than 1200 concerts in 25 states. The Texas rock scene was the best in the country – Dallas, Ft Worth and Houston .. everyone had a seat 500-1000 pack the club 4 nights a week – every week. From its headquarters in Dallas, the band ventured out of the Midwest, New England, East Coast, Florida and the south – all packed clubs and wild parties.
